Two new cave-dwelling Prionoglarididae from Venezuela and Namibia

Two new cave-dwelling Prionoglarididae from Venezuela and Namibia
(Psocodea: ‘Psocoptera’: Trogiomorpha).

- The new genus Speleopsocus
Lienhard gen. n. is described for a strongly cave-adapted (troglobite) new
species from Venezuela, Speleopsocus chimanta Lienhard sp. n. This is the
first New World representative of the subfamily Prionoglaridinae. A special
structure on the foretarsus of this species is described and interpreted as an
antenna cleaner. The new species Sensitibilla etosha Lienhard & Holuša
sp. n., belonging to the subfamily Speleketorinae, is described from a cave
in Namibia. This is the fourth species known of this genus which is endemic
to southern Africa.
